Job description
Location: Free State Provincial Office
Division: Provinces
Organisation: HWSETA
Employment Type: Permanent
Salary: R300 901 – R379 709 per annum (Cost to Company)
Job Purpose
The HWSETA is seeking to appoint a Provincial Administrator to provide administrative, operational and stakeholder support within the Free State Provincial Office. The successful candidate will be responsible for coordinating administrative processes, maintaining records, supporting programme implementation, assisting stakeholders, and ensuring efficient office operations in line with organisational policies and service delivery standard.
Minimum Requirements
Education
- National Diploma in Office Administration/Technology, Business Administration, Public Management or an equivalent qualification.
Experience
- 2 to 3 years' experience in Office Administration or a related field.
Key Responsibility Areas
1. Administrative Support
- Provide administrative support to the Provincial Office.
- Prepare correspondence, reports, presentations and meeting documentation.
- Maintain efficient filing and record management systems.
- Manage incoming and outgoing correspondence.
- Coordinate meetings, workshops and stakeholder engagements.
- Ensure effective office administration and document control.
2. Programme Administration
- Support the implementation of learning programmes and other HWSETA initiatives.
- Assist with the coordination of workshops, site visits and stakeholder events.
- Maintain accurate programme records and databases.
- Monitor submission and tracking of required documentation.
3. Stakeholder Support
- Respond to stakeholder enquiries and provide administrative assistance.
- Assist employers, training providers and stakeholders with administrative processes.
- Ensure excellent customer service and timely communication.
- Escalate unresolved queries where necessary.
4. Records and Information Management
- Maintain electronic and manual filing systems.
- Ensure accurate capturing and safekeeping of documents.
- Support compliance with information management and record-keeping requirements.
- Prepare reports and statistical information as required.
5. Corporate Services Support
- Implement and adhere to organisational policies and procedures.
- Assist with procurement, asset control and logistical arrangements.
- Support travel and accommodation arrangements where required.
- Assist with office planning, reporting and operational activities.
6. Marketing and Stakeholder Engagement
- Support career exhibitions, advocacy initiatives and marketing activities.
- Assist with stakeholder communication and awareness campaigns.
- Promote positive stakeholder relations and customer satisfaction.
7. Service Delivery Standards
- Ensure timely responses to telephone and email enquiries.
- Acknowledge receipt of submitted documentation within prescribed timelines.
- Maintain professional service delivery standards in all stakeholder interactions.
